i have win2k advance server and windows 98 on the same machine (without LAN). when i use my dial up connection (56kbps) its pretty fast on win 98 but its very slow in win2k. i have also noticed that as soon as the connection is established in win2k lot of data is sent without the browser being open. this dose not happen in win 98.
can anyone please tell me if any services have to be stopped in win2k or any other methods to improve the speed of internet connection ?

Hi Jack.
Both Windows Versions should be Much the same, if you have the same programs loaded on both. But if you are worried about the amount of data being sent, I suggest you run a firewall to block unwanted traffic. One of the worst things for doing this I have found is spyware. Try running AD-Aware to see if your computer is clean. Hope this helps Jack. Have a nice day.
